What skills and experience we're looking for

Mayflower Community Academy are looking for enthusiastic and hard-working, creative practitioners, who are able to both care for and support our children. Teaching Assistant candidates must have GCSE Maths and English C/4 or above and be able to illustrate good literacy and numeracy skills. Applicants must either hold or be working towards an NVQ2/3 or equivalent qualification/experience and have the ability to develop positive behaviour strategies with children. They must also be good team players willing to go the extra mile for our children and the community.

This Teaching Assistant position will be primary based in the Support Centre.
